The Process of Surrogacy
What is Surrogacy?
Surrogacy is an arrangement where a woman, known as a surrogate or gestational carrier, carries and gives birth to a child for another person or couple. The surrogate is not genetically related to the child, who is created using the intended parents’ eggs and sperm through IVF.

Benefits and Challenges of Surrogacy
Benefits
- Alternative path to parenthood: Surrogacy offers hope to those who cannot carry a pregnancy to term.
- Genetic connection: Intended parents can use their own eggs and sperm, providing a biological link to their child.
- Control over the process: Intended parents can choose the surrogate and stay involved in the pregnancy journey.
Challenges
- Ethical considerations: Surrogacy raises ethical questions about the nature of motherhood and the potential exploitation of surrogates.
- Legal complexities: Surrogacy laws vary from state to state, making it essential to navigate legal implications carefully.
- Financial burden: Surrogacy can be an expensive process, involving medical fees, legal expenses, and surrogate compensation.
